Colostrum Side Effects

 

Colostrum is the most important food an offspring can receive from its mother in mammals. Because of the various health benefits of colostrum, many people use it on a regular basis. Bovine colostrum is the ideal substitute for human colostrum as it is not species specific.

Although there are no obvious side effects of colostrum consumption, some people may experience mild side effects depending on the nature of their body and the quantity of colostrum intake. Usually, when you consume colostrum, a variety of toxins are flushed out from your body. When this is happening, you may experience flu-like symptoms. But this is only temporary and will subside as the toxins are completely flushed out from your body.

Side effects like abdominal discomfort and/or diarrhea may also occur when the colostrum consumption is too high and too fast. In strict medical terms, abdominal discomfort and/or diarrhea is not a side effect but the process where the body gets rid of the toxins accumulated during the illness. In any case, you must consult your doctor before consuming colostrum on a regular basis. If you are allergic to milk and milk products, you may experience headache, muscle aches, or stomach distress.

If you suffer from hyperthyroid disease, you should consult your doctor. Although there is no substantial evidence regarding the effect of colostrum on patients suffering from hyperthyroid disease, in some patients the disease worsened after regular consumption.

Also, if you have an injury or wound, there may be heightened pain in these areas while the wound is healing. Under these circumstances, it's wise to lower consumption of colostrum until the pain subsides.

There are no proven side effects of colostrum. The above-mentioned symptoms are temporary and rare. Still, if you are pregnant, nursing, or on medications, consult your doctor before you consume colostrum.
